Alabama HB 489 (2020rs) — Escambia Co., law enforcement, authorized to take an individual with mental illness into protective custody under certain conditions, protection from civil and criminal liabilities
Version chain
The bill's text revisions, in order — the diff chain from filing to enrollment.
Votes
- Motion to Read a Third Time and Pass adopted Roll Call 665 — 28–0 (pass) · upper
- Motion to Read a Third Time and Pass adopted Roll Call 410 — 39–0 (pass) · lower
Sponsors
- Baker — primary (person)
Timeline
The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.
- 2020-05-04T04:00:00+00:00 Read for the first time and referred to the House of Representatives committee on Local Legislation
reading-1, referral-committee - 2020-05-05T04:00:00+00:00 Read for the second time and placed on the calendar
reading-2 - 2020-05-06T04:00:00+00:00 Third Reading Passed
passage - 2020-05-06T04:00:00+00:00 Motion to Read a Third Time and Pass adopted Roll Call 410
passage - 2020-05-07T04:00:00+00:00 Read for the first time and referred to the Senate committee on Local Legislation
reading-1, referral-committee - 2020-05-08T04:00:00+00:00 Read for the second time and placed on the calendar
reading-2 - 2020-05-09T04:00:00+00:00 Third Reading Passed
passage - 2020-05-09T04:00:00+00:00 Motion to Read a Third Time and Pass adopted Roll Call 665
passage - 2020-05-09T04:00:00+00:00 Passed Second House
passage - 2020-05-09T04:00:00+00:00 Enrolled
- 2020-05-09T04:00:00+00:00 Signature Requested
- 2020-05-09T04:00:00+00:00 Clerk of the House Certification
- 2020-05-09T04:00:00+00:00 Assigned Act No. 2020-196.
executive-signature - 2020-05-09T04:00:00+00:00 Delivered to Governor at 3:33 p.m. on May 9, 2020.
